The farm at 2 Tyler's Way, Lakeville MAThis equine property, 2 Tyler's Way, Lakeville MA, is a private 60-acre parcel with an 8-stall barn and acres and acres of pasture near Bedford Street, Lakeville.

The 5,342 square foot home, located at the end of a long private driveway, has 11 rooms, with five bedrooms and 6 full and 2 half bathrooms.  Two fireplaces, a full gym, central air and a large media room that opens to a secluded patio are only a few of the wonderful features in this classic Cape home. There's another 1,673 square feet of finished walk-out basement that is not included in the living area.

The large kitchen includes double ovens, custom cabinets and granite counters, and opens to a huge sunroom with surrounding bay windows above a window seat.

The master bedroom has his-and-her baths with a steam shower and jetted soaker tub.

An upstairs in-law apartment includes 1 1/2 bathrooms, a breakfast bar, and separate washer/dryer and internet hookups. A 3-car garage is attached.
